Compare specifications (specs)
NVIDIA RTX A2000 12 GB | NVIDIA Tesla T10 Processor | |
---|---|---|
Essentials |
||
Architecture | Ampere | Tesla 2.0 |
Code name | GA106 | GT200B |
Launch date | 23 Nov 2021 | 9 April 2009 |
Place in performance rating | 82 | 84 |
Type | Workstation | |
Technical info |
||
Boost clock speed | 1200 MHz | |
Core clock speed | 562 MHz | 610 MHz |
Manufacturing process technology | 8 nm | 55 nm |
Peak Double Precision (FP64) Performance | 124.8 GFLOPS (1:64) | |
Peak Half Precision (FP16) Performance | 7.987 TFLOPS (1:1) | |
Peak Single Precision (FP32) Performance | 7.987 TFLOPS | |
Pipelines | 3328 | 240 |
Pixel fill rate | 57.60 GPixel/s | |
Texture fill rate | 124.8 GTexel/s | 48.8 GTexel / s |
Thermal Design Power (TDP) | 70 Watt | 188 Watt |
Transistor count | 12000 million | 1,400 million |
Floating-point performance | 622.1 gflops | |
Video outputs and ports |
||
Display Connectors | 4x mini-DisplayPort 1.4a | No outputs |
Compatibility, dimensions and requirements |
||
Form factor | Dual-slot | |
Interface | PCIe 4.0 x16 | PCIe 2.0 x16 |
Length | 167 mm, 6.6 inches | 267 mm |
Recommended system power (PSU) | 250 Watt | |
Supplementary power connectors | None | |
Width | 69 mm, 2.7 inches | |
API support |
||
DirectX | 12 Ultimate (12_2) | 10.0 |
OpenCL | 3.0 | |
OpenGL | 4.6 | 3.3 |
Shader Model | 6.7 | |
Vulkan | ||
Memory |
||
Maximum RAM amount | 12 GB | 4 GB |
Memory bandwidth | 288.0 GB/s | 102.4 GB / s |
Memory bus width | 192 bit | 512 Bit |
Memory clock speed | 1500 MHz, 12 Gbps effective | 1600 MHz |
Memory type | GDDR6 | GDDR3 |
